The ingredients needed to make Greek Marinade Lamb Chops:
  1. Take (8) lamb chops
  2. Make ready olive oil
  3. Get lemon juice
  4. Get dried oregano
  5. Make ready table salt
  6. Prepare garlic, minced
  7. Take Kosher salt, fresh ground pepper
Instructions to make Greek Marinade Lamb Chops:
  1. Combine olive oil, lemon juice, oregano, salt, and garlic cloves. Brush marinade over all sides of the separated lamb chops.
  2. Cover with plastic wrap and leave in refrigerator for at least a half hour. Longer is better.
  3. Preheat a large cast iron pan to medium heat. Sear on each side for 5-6 minutes. Finish each side with kosher salt and fresh pepper to taste.
